Unveiling Coral-Associated Copepod Diversity: Implications for Tropical Reef Ecosystems

This study synthesizes global knowledge on coral-associated copepod diversity, integrating 160 published taxonomic investigations with recent molecular datasets from the Indo-Pacific and the Caribbean. Research focuses specifically on the coral families Pocilloporidae and Euphylliidae (including Galaxea), alongside the highly diversified copepod family Anchimolgidae.
By combining taxonomic and molecular evidence, this work uncovers critical hidden diversity, previously unrecognized host associations, and pronounced zoogeographic fragmentation among copepod assemblages across distinct reef ecoregions. Notably, this distribution reveals a highly unique pattern of strong regional structuring and broad host specificity across taxa, which diverges from trends documented in other coral-associated invertebrates or algal symbionts. Ultimately, this synthesis delineates major knowledge gaps and illuminates emerging biogeographic and ecological paradigms vital for deciphering coral–copepod symbioses across tropical reef systems.
